AFM in Biology Class

This comprehensive class, now in its 11th session, is open to all AFM scientists that wish to expand their AFM knowledge as it pertains to life science applications. The unparalleled training includes both lecture and extensive hands-on experiments. The three day training course will focus on:

  • Basic AFM operation (as demonstrated on the MFP-3D AFM) 
  • Biological sample preparation and interpretation of AFM data
  • Choosing cantilevers
  • Imaging samples in air and fluids: from molecules to cells
  • Force measurements: intra molecular forces and hardness measurements
  • Simultaneous AFM and optical microscopy techniques including fluorescence and phase contrast
  • Recognizing artifacts

The class will be tailored to the skill level of the participants. You may download a PDF of the information packet that includes additional information and the registration form.
